King Charles echoes his grandfather George VI as he pays tribute to D-Day veterans who faced 'supreme test' but 'did not flinch when the moment came' at 80th anniversary memorial service

King Charles has paid tribute to the 'remarkable wartime generation' who made the ultimate sacrifice to keep the world safe from tyranny on the 80th anniversary of the D-Day landings. Speaking to commemorate the veterans in Normandy, he expressed his 'profound sense of gratitude' for the men and woman 'who did not flinch when the moment came to face that test.' He described the 'supreme test' faced by the troops, in reference to the speech made by his grandfather, George VI, who broadcast to the nation 80 years ago: 'Once more a supreme test has to be faced.
